A rectangular framed artwork, described as being from Ouaouizert, Morocco, is centrally positioned against a dark, out-of-focus background. The frame itself is approximately 1.5 inches wide, displaying a golden-brown hue with an embossed, intricate floral and scrollwork pattern. Minor surface damage or dust is discernible along the upper edge of the frame. Within this frame, the artwork features a solid reddish-brown background. Elevated, metallic silver Arabic calligraphy, identified as Ayat al-Kursī (The Throne Verse) from the Quran, is horizontally arranged in multiple lines across the central field. A small inscription at the bottom center reads "آية الكرسي" (Ayat al-Kursi) followed by the numeral "٤٠٣". Complementing the calligraphy, embossed decorative elements comprising light pink or pale purple leaf and vine motifs are present in the four corners and along the vertical margins of the central text block. No individuals, additional objects, or specific environmental features beyond the immediate dark background are visible.
